Abstract :
Research on target´s bistatic radar cross section (RCS) is attracting more and more attention nowadays. As the most widely used calibration object, understanding sphere´s scattering characteristic will make sense in bistatic RCS measurement. In this paper, the bistatic scattering mechanism is analysed first. On this basis, we discuss sphere´s scattering characteristic in both frequency and bistatic angle domain. Finally, a simplified Mie series is deduced to calculate the forward RCS of metal sphere and is validated via experiment data. Some interesting results are also introduced.
